Contents:
Happy jack (The Who) -- Itchycoo Park (Small Faces) -- Homburg (Procol Harum) -- Sorry Suzanne (The Hollies) -- Hip hip hooray (The Troggs) -- Man of the world (Fleetwood Mac) -- In the year 2525 (Zager & Evans) -- Hang onto a dream (The Nice) -- Wild tiger woman (The Move) -- Jesamine (The Casuals) -- I'm the urban spaceman (Bonzo Dog Doo Dah Band) -- Plastic man (The Kinks) -- Surfin' USA (The Beach Boys) -- Ha! Ha! Said the clown (Manfred Mann) -- Nights in white satin (The Moody Blues) -- Friday on my mind (The Easybeats) -- Technicolor dreams (Status Quo) -- Ferry cross the Mersey (Gerry and the Pacemakers) -- I can't make it (Small Faces) -- So sad about us (The Who).
Summary:
20 original television performances from some of the most popular music groups in the 1960s.
